My Buying Guides on Trampoline Net And Poles

Why I Pay Attention to the Net and Poles

When I look for a trampoline, I never focus only on the jumping mat. For me, the net and poles matter just as much because they help keep the trampoline safe and stable. A strong enclosure gives me peace of mind, especially if kids will be using it. I always check whether the net is tall enough, tightly woven, and securely attached to the frame.

Choosing the Right Net Material

In my experience, the net material makes a big difference in durability. I prefer UV-resistant polyethylene or similar weather-resistant materials because they hold up better outdoors. If the net feels thin or flimsy, I usually avoid it. I also like nets with fine mesh because they reduce the chance of fingers getting caught.

What I Look for in the Poles

The poles are just as important to me as the net itself. I usually look for thick, rust-resistant steel poles with good padding. I feel safer when the poles are curved or designed to sit away from the jumping area, since that lowers the risk of impact. If the poles seem weak or poorly padded, I pass on that option.

Safety Features I Never Ignore

Safety is always my top priority. I check for:

  • Strong zipper or latch closure on the net entrance
  • Secure pole attachments
  • Thick pole padding
  • High enclosure netting
  • Compatibility with the trampoline size

If any of these features are missing, I usually keep shopping.

Matching the Net and Poles to the Trampoline Size

I always make sure the net and poles fit the exact trampoline size. A mismatch can make installation frustrating and can also affect safety. Before I buy, I check the diameter and height of the trampoline and compare it with the product description. I’ve learned that even a small sizing mistake can lead to a poor fit.

Indoor vs Outdoor Use

If I plan to keep the trampoline outside, I choose materials built to resist sun, rain, and wind. For outdoor use, I prefer stronger poles and weatherproof netting. If the trampoline is going indoors or under cover, I still want durability, but I may not need the same level of weather resistance.

Ease of Installation

I like products that come with clear instructions and all the hardware I need. Some trampoline nets and poles are easy to assemble, while others can be frustrating. I usually look for user reviews that mention installation because they give me a better idea of what to expect. If assembly looks overly complicated, I think twice before buying.

Replacement vs Full Set

Sometimes I only need a replacement net or a new set of poles, and other times I need both. I always check whether the parts are sold separately or as a complete enclosure system. Buying the wrong type can waste money, so I make sure I know exactly what I need before placing an order.
